Chinese New Year is incomplete without Bak Kwa, also called Chinese pork jerky. Minced porked mixed with rice wine, soy sauce, fish sauce, oil, pepper, other flavory spices, ​and sugar is cooled in the fridge, at first, then pork layers flattened over the sheets of paper are baked in the oven and finally cut into smaller slices pork is grilled until ready.

The delicacy might be found in Singapore year-round, but its season falls on the Lunar New Year celebration from late January to early February. You can also buy wrapped Bak Kwa​ slices and bring them home as delicious souvenirs.
